Abstract

In an example aspect, a method includes receiving, using a hardware processing device, a first classification of a network address associated with a login attempt as an account validator actor. The method also includes based on the first classification, updating, using the hardware processing device, a system deny list to include the network address for a first length of time. The method also includes after expiration of the first length of time removing the network address from the system deny list, receiving a second of classification of the network address as an account validator actor, and updating the system deny list to include the network address for a second length of time.
